Output d3d56cf705b1ac0faa9be50bbb8e778a69b752129ab7c622082c3963822033a9:144

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c1c20ed245437ef5bd2cfd75397a5b6a8d11fd1d4fc059f59e5e95a20e7fba5
address
bc1ptswzpmfy2sm77k7jelt489a9k65dz8736n7qt86euh545g88lwjsvfllmn
transaction
d3d56cf705b1ac0faa9be50bbb8e778a69b752129ab7c622082c3963822033a9
spent
true